Responsibilities
- Provide guidance and technical support to plant management regarding Environmental & Sustainability programs and procedures.
- Develop benchmarks for the implementation of sustainability initiatives that drive continuous improvement and operational excellence.
- Act as the subject matter expert with respect to compliance with federal, provincial, and municipal environmental compliance matters.
- Accountable for identifying trends and areas of improvement and communicating with leadership and plant management teams.
- Accountable for identifying, developing, and delivering environmental training requirements for implementation at the plant level.
- Act as a lead in the development and execution of plant-level sustainability audits.
- Collect and analyze statistical data pertaining to the plant's sustainability program.
- Prepare reports to support sustainability initiatives.
- Maintain and develop current knowledge of federal, provincial, and municipal environmental regulatory requirements.
- Participate in corporate environmental initiatives (such as conference calls, audits, etc.) to ensure site representation, inclusion, and consistency.
- Develop and maintain an environmental calendar.

Requirements
- Degree in Environmental or Industrial Engineering.
- Certified Environmental Professional (CEP) or Environmental Professional (EP) or similar credentials is a must-have.
- 8+ years of experience in environmental sustainability roles, specifically within a manufacturing environment, preferably within the food industry.
- Strong knowledge of interprovincial regulatory requirements for the management of air, odour, noise, water, and waste/hazardous waste is a must.
- Hands-on experience working on cost-saving projects and initiatives.
- Knowledge of federal, provincial, and municipal environmental regulations.
- Experience in the development and continuous improvement of environmental management programs (Sustainability, TQEM, ISO 14001, etc.).
- Strong collaboration and consensus-building capabilities, and analytical skills.
- Contractor management experience.
- Ability to travel 40-50%, locally and nationwide.
